What is 'application type' in SAP GRC-IAG - SAP Cloud Identity Access Governance?


application type - Overview


application type - Details


  • Key Concepts: Application type is a term used in SAP Cloud Identity Access Governance (GRC-IAG) to refer to the type of application that is being managed. It can be either an on-premise application, a cloud application, or a hybrid application. The application type determines the access control policies that are applied to the application.
    How to use it: When setting up an application in GRC-IAG, the user must select the appropriate application type. This will determine which access control policies are applied to the application. For example, if the application is an on-premise application, then the user must select the “On-Premise” option when setting up the application.
    Tips & Tricks: It is important to select the correct application type when setting up an application in GRC-IAG. This will ensure that the correct access control policies are applied to the application.
